Article by: Niko Mann The Jackson family in Upper Marlboro, Maryland is honoring the country’s legacy of Black cowboys. The family sat down with Good Morning America to discuss their rodeo lifestyle. Corey Jackson and Robyn Jackson met at the Bill Pickett Invitational Rodeo, a rodeo known for celebrating Black cowboys and cowgirls. Family, integrity, community, faith, and hard work. These principles are the driving force in the heart of the cowboy. In her newest title, American Cowboys, photographer Anouk Masson Kranz journeys solo across America where she shares the intimate lives and families of this private, elusive icon of the American West. This year, the Rodeo Houston Hall of Fame welcomed three legendary faces into the historic circle of rodeo stars. Rodeo Houston’s history and on-going legacy has made a significant impact on countless careers, including 11 time World Champion Barrel Racer Charmayne James.
